This tour begins at the Yonghe Lamasery and one of the best examples of the regions many sacred temples. Lama Temple reveals diverse architectural styles from Han, Mongolia, Manchuria and Tibet, and the impressive 60-foot Maitreya Buddha, carved form a single sandalwood tree. Then its on to one of the highpoints of anyone visiting Beijing, a trip to the zoo to see the frolicking Pandas, a living Chinese treasure.
After or before a stop for lunch, you will visit the Emperors retreat, the historic Summer Palace. Used for eight centuries, the Empress Dowager Cixi had the estate renovated in the 19th century, including the manmade lake we see today.
